linux白名单怎么命令添加

fiy 其他 38

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要在Linux系统中添加白名单,可以使用以下命令:

    1. 使用文本编辑器打开需要修改的配置文件。常见的配置文件包括`/etc/hosts.allow`和`/etc/hosts.deny`。
    例如:
    “`
    sudo vi /etc/hosts.allow
    “`

    2. 编辑配置文件,在文件中添加需要允许访问的IP地址或者主机名。每个地址或名称占一行。
    例如:
    “`
    sshd: 192.168.1.100
    httpd: example.com
    “`

    3. 保存并关闭文件。

    4. 重启相应的服务以使更改生效,或者重新加载相关配置文件。具体的命令根据不同的服务而有所不同。
    例如,重启SSH服务:
    “`
    sudo systemctl restart sshd
    “`

    以上步骤是用来在Linux系统中添加白名单的常规方法。但请注意,具体的步骤可能因为使用的Linux发行版和配置文件位置而有所差异。因此,在进行任何修改之前,请参考相关文档或查询特定发行版的指南,以确保正确地添加白名单规则。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要在Linux上添加白名单,可以使用以下命令:

    1. 确定要添加白名单的应用程序或服务的名称或路径。例如,假设要添加的应用程序为`/usr/bin/appname`。

    2. 打开终端,以管理员身份登录到Linux系统。

    3. 使用`sudo`命令以root权限运行以下命令,打开要编辑的配置文件。以下示例是使用文本编辑器`vi`,你也可以使用其他文本编辑器。
    “`
    sudo vi /etc/whitelist
    “`

    4. 在打开的配置文件中,以每行一个的方式将要添加到白名单的应用程序或服务的名称或路径添加进去。以下示例为在`/etc/whitelist`文件中添加`/usr/bin/appname`。保存并关闭文件。

    5. 运行以下命令以确保添加的白名单生效。
    “`
    sudo systemctl restart serviceName
    “`
    其中`serviceName`是你要重启的服务的名称。例如,如果要重启Apache服务,命令为`sudo systemctl restart apache2`。

    添加白名单时,需要确保以下几点:

    – 需要具有管理员权限或root权限才能编辑配置文件和重启服务。
    – 白名单中的每个条目应该位于单独的一行。
    – 白名单文件的路径和文件名可以根据需要进行更改。
    – 白名单的生效取决于所使用的服务或应用程序,可能需要重新启动服务或应用程序。

    请注意,由于Linux系统的不同发行版和不同的配置文件位置,实际的命令和路径可能会有所不同。这只是一个通用的示例,具体情况请根据你正在使用的Linux发行版和具体配置文件进行调整。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,可以使用白名单来限制特定的操作或者访问。白名单是一个允许操作或访问的列表,只有在该列表中的项目才能执行或访问。通过命令添加白名单可以提高系统的安全性。

    下面是在Linux系统中使用命令添加白名单的操作流程:

    1. 查找要添加到白名单的应用或服务的路径
    在命令行中使用`which`命令或`whereis`命令来查找要添加到白名单的应用程序或服务的路径。例如,要添加`nginx`服务到白名单,可以使用以下命令:
    “`bash
    which nginx
    “`

    2. 创建白名单文件
    在任意位置创建一个文本文件来存储白名单,例如`whitelist.txt`。可以使用文本编辑器(如`vi`或`nano`)来创建和编辑文件。在白名单文件中将每个应用或服务的路径写在单独的一行上。

    3. 添加应用或服务到白名单
    在白名单文件中写入要添加到白名单的应用或服务的路径。例如,将`nginx`服务添加到白名单文件中,可以在`whitelist.txt`文件中写入以下内容:
    “`
    /usr/sbin/nginx
    “`

    4. 将白名单应用或服务设置为可执行
    对于可执行文件,需要将其添加到系统的可执行路径中,或者为该文件添加可执行权限。可以使用以下命令将文件添加到可执行路径中:
    “`bash
    sudo cp /path/to/your/file /usr/local/bin/
    “`
    或者通过以下命令添加可执行权限:
    “`bash
    sudo chmod +x /path/to/your/file
    “`

    5. 应用白名单
    最后,需要在系统中应用白名单。可以使用以下命令将白名单文件中的应用或服务设置为可执行权限:
    “`bash
    sudo chmod +x whitelist.txt
    “`

    6. 测试白名单
    完成以上步骤后,可以通过运行应用或服务来测试白名单是否生效。如果应用或服务在白名单中,则可以正常使用,否则将无法执行或访问。

    请注意,具体的添加白名单命令可能因系统和发行版而有所不同,以上命令仅作为示例。在实际操作时,请根据系统和应用程序的不同进行调整。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部